Right on all counts, Gipper. As Kelly said, it was simply blown coverage on FSU's part. ND came out spread wide right. FSU was fine at that point. Then ND shifted down into the triangle cluster just outside the TE slot. That is where FSU's #26 got lost. He got stuck on the inside. When Procise was immediately jammed at the line by his defender #26 started looking around. At that point he knows he is out of position. When Fuller runs the penetrating slant #26 was completely out of the play. He sees Robinson release into the wide open flat. he is tearing hs own helmet off as the ball is cradled by Robinson. One of his own team mates immediately starts waving his arms at #26 and yelling. They were yelling at each other, not the official. There should have been no call. Or two calls. And then ND would have had at lease two more shots from the nine.
